Another individual that will be competing this weekend with some real height is Elise Pederson of Omaha Westside High School. Pederson has been a household name in Nebraska for Westside for a couple of years now and she is starting to bring in more interest as she moves into her Senior year. This is a SF that produces as a post. She has muscle mass to pair with her size and that helps her convert by the bucket. She can either go over smaller defenders or through bigger ones, if need be. She can also step out and pass from the outside at times when she can see the entire floor from the top of the key. I’m not sure where Pederson will end up when she commits but she is sure to have some options, especially at her size.
On a talented Omaha Westside team this winter that advanced to the Class A state tournament, Pederson played her role in the post well. She averaged just over eight points per game and was the Warriors second-leading rebounder at 5.4 per contest. Will play with Medeck and company this spring and summer for ETG where her game could really impress college coaches.

is going to be one of this team’s enforcers in the middle of the lane. Pederson has always had size along with great balance and knowledge of situation basketball. At the same time, she has also really progressed as she has gotten older. Two years ago, you would not think that Pederson would make this ETG 15U line up in my opinion. She was a bigger body but that was about it. This past six months though, she has really locked in and grown into her own. She has gained a softer touch on the ball, coordination on the catch or pass, and she communicates with everyone else around her on the floor at an impressive rate. The most important part of a prospect moving into a successful AAU program is their fit. As long as Pederson plays aggressively but calculated, she is going to do just fine and even be this groups standout player at times.
